Finnish forests grow by almost 100 million cubic meters a year, and just over half of it has been used in recent years. We are worried about rural depopulation, so could we not produce energy by utilizing our renewable energy sources locally and this way create more jobs in the countryside?

Volter's CHP-plant is a self-sufficient solution that uses wood chips to provide all the electricity and heat required for an entire housing estate. For example, it takes approximately 20 cubic meters of wood to cover the annual electricity and heating needs and to charge an electric car for a family of six.
